[!NOTE] pgplex: Modern Developer Stack for Postgres - pgconsole · pgtui · pgschema · pgparser Brought to you by Bytebase, open-source database DevSecOps platform. pgconsole is a web-based PostgreSQL editor. Single binary, single config file, no database required. Connect your team to PostgreSQL with access control and audit logging built in. <img alt="Star History Chart"
